Vancouver (/vænˈkuËvÉ™r/ van-KOO-vÉ™r) is a major city in western Canada, located in the Lower Mainland region of British Columbia. As the most populous city in the province, the 2021 Canadian census recorded 662,248 people in the city, up from 631,486 in 2016. The Metro Vancouver area had a population of 2.6 million in 2021, making it the third-largest metropolitan area in Canada. Greater Vancouver, along with the Fraser Valley, comprises the Lower Mainland with a regional population of over 3 million. Vancouver has the highest population density in Canada, with over 5,700 people per square kilometre, and fourth highest in North America (after New York City, San Francisco, and Mexico City).
Patellar Femoral Syndrome (PFS), more colloquially known as Runner’s Knee, is a term most athletes, especially runners, are regrettably familiar with. It’s a knee condition that can significantly impede one’s ability to engage in physical activity, particularly when transitioning from a sedentary lifestyle to a more active one.
